Claude Design vs. Open Design: 웹 개발의 현실
Source: Dev.to

디자인 서사: 모든 것이 시작된 곳
웹사이트 디자인에 대해 이야기할 때 가장 먼저 떠오르는 것은 시각적인 요소, 색상, 폰트입니다. 하지만 엔지니어 입장에서는 구조, 확장성, 유지보수성을 바라봅니다. 바로 그때 저는 Claude Design과 Open Design이라는 이분법을 마주하게 되었습니다.
- Claude Design – 많은 규칙을 강제하는 프레임워크와 도구를 사용하는 보다 폐쇄적인 접근 방식입니다. 매우 구체적인 드래그‑앤‑드롭 사이트 빌더나 대기업의 독점 디자인 시스템을 떠올리시면 됩니다. 약속은 속도와 일관성: 플러그인, 드래그, 바로 완성.
- Open Design – 완전한 자유. 순수 HTML, CSS, JavaScript, 혹은 React나 Vue 같은 프론트엔드 프레임워크를 사용할 수 있지만 폐쇄된 시스템의 제약은 없습니다. 완전한 제어를 원하는 사람을 위한 백지 상태입니다.
나의 실험과 현실의 고통
Claude Design
- 장점: 초기 속도가 어마어마하게 빠름; 빠른 프로토타입이나 시각 가이드라인이 이미 정의된 단순 기업 사이트에 이상적.
- 단점: 고객이 예기치 않은 기능을 요구하면 복잡한 우회가 필요하고, “임시 코드”가 늘어나며 유지보수가 어려워짐.
Open Design
- 장점: 복잡한 인터페이스, 애니메이션, 실제로 참여를 유도하는 상호작용을 자유롭게 구현 가능; 픽셀 단위 성능 최적화; 어떤 API와도 손쉽게 통합; 팀이 직접 제어하므로 유지보수가 간단.
- 단점: 개발 시간, 디자인 및 리팩토링에 더 많은 시간이 소요; 높은 수준의 기술력을 가진 팀이 필요; 예산이 매우 빠듯한 경우에는 부적합.
배운 점과 고려해야 할 사항
-
요구사항이 명확하고, 극단적인 커스터마이징이 거의 필요 없으며, 일정이 촉박한 프로젝트?
Claude Design을 선택하세요 – 캠페인 랜딩 페이지, 이벤트 사이트 등에 최적. 향후 발생할 수 있는 제약을 인지하세요. -
복잡한 프로젝트, 독특한 기능, 높은 인터랙티브성 또는 진화하는 시각적 아이덴티티가 필요한 경우?
Open Design을 선택하세요 – 더 많은 시간을 투자하고, 확장성과 시장 적응성을 보장할 수 있는 견고한 팀을 구성하세요.
실제 예시와 추가 상세 내용을 보려면 유튜브 전체 영상을 시청하세요: Claude Design vs. Open Design – A Realidade no Desenvolvimento Web.
결국 남는 질문은: 당신은 금빛 우리 안의 편리함을 선호하나요, 아니면 스스로 날개를 펴고 날아다니는 자유(그리고 그에 따른 작업)를 선호하나요?